I'd never say "never" when it comes to the use of the ALL button, but in most instances if you don't have any better insight than "ALL" underneath, I think your returns would be better just playing the N-1 horses vertical wager. So if instead of using ALL in the third spot for the trifecta, play the exacta. Usually trying to maufacture a bigger payoff ends up costing you value.
